Description
Explores the effects of fortification, the addition of nutrients to processed foods, and biofortification, the modification of crops to produce more nutritious yields, on the Third World food problem, and discusses how the voices of women were silenced despite their expertise in food purchasing and preparation in response to this problem. Examines the case studies of Golden Rice, a crop genetically engineered to alleviate vitamin A deficiencies, and attempts to enrich and market rice, wheat flour, and baby food in Indonesia.
